      The time has come to replace my facemill inserts.

      The facemill was bought (with unreserved happiness and joy), some while ago from RDG.

      Their replacement inserts are coded TPUN 16 03.

      However, I like to buy my inserts from JB Cutting Tools. Jenny lists this insert as TPKN 16 03.

      Can anybody enlighten me as to the difference, please ?

            TPUN is a turning insert geometry but can be used for milling but not as robust, go for TPUN 160308 the 08 being the radius on the tip cutting edge.

            TPKN is a milling insert same triangular shape and thickness but the KN denotes ground facets on the cutting edge instead of the 08 radius more robust and a better finish, also more expensive

              I use TPUN16-03-08 inserts for milling, a quick touch on a diamond wheel and they cut well.
